There are two types of Contracts tracked by MKMS:
1.Contracts which are the Monitoring Contracts used by the Central Station Monitoring module:
a.In order to identify your Subscriber's Monitoring Related Contract information, you must first create the Codes and Descriptions representing these Monitoring Related Contract Types which are offered by your Company.
b.Monitoring Contract Types are defined by Choosing Maintenance from the Main Menu and Selecting the Central Station sub-menu then Clicking Contract Types.

Contract Type Form

 

c.These User-Defined Monitoring Contract types (documented in "Defining the Contract Types" below) are used to identify the type of Monitoring Related Services that are being provided to each Subscriber.
d.The Monitoring Contract is assigned to a Subscriber using the Contracts Form.
e.A Subscriber may have more than one Monitoring Contract type in force (and a Subscriber may have more than one CSID assigned, as well).

 

2.Contracts which are the Service Contracts used by the Service Tracking System module:
a.In order to assign your Subscriber's Service Related Contract information, you must first create the Codes and Descriptions representing the Service Contracts being offered by your Company.
b. Service Contracts are defined by Choosing Maintenance from the Main Menu and Selecting Service Tracking Items and Choosing Service Contracts.

Service Contracts Form

 

c.These User-Defined Service Contract types are used for identifying a Subscriber's Extended Warranty and/or Service Agreement
d.The Service Contract is assigned within the Service Info tab of the Subscribers Form.
e.Only one Service Contract may be assigned to each Subscriber.

 

Defining the Contract Types - Before identifying a Subscriber's Monitoring Related Contract information, you must create the Codes and Descriptions representing the Monitoring Related Contract Types being offered by your Company.
Contract Types represent what monitoring related, and contracted for, services are being provided to Subscribers
The definition and assignment of Contract Types is a requirement for UL® Accounts and therefore is a required Central Station Monitoring module start-up process.
Having the appropriate Contract Type specifically identified for a UL® Listed Subscriber is a UL® requirement for those Accounts.
Also, by entering your Monitoring Related Contract Types for the Monitoring Services being provided for each Subscriber enables the functionality of the Subscribers with No Contract report.
To be able to assign this Monitoring Related Contracts information to a Subscriber:
Create the Contract Types that are being offered (as explained below)
Assign the Contract Type(s) that each Subscriber has taken in the Subscribers Form's General Quick Access Menu's Contracts option.
Subscribers may have more than one Contract Type assigned to the same Account.

 

The Monitoring Related Contract Types are defined by Choosing Maintenance from the Main Menu, Selecting the Central Station sub-menu, then Clicking Contract Types option.
This selection displays the Contract Types Form (a sample of which is shown below).

To define the Contract Types being offered - one or more of which are which are entered in each monitored Subscriber's Contracts Form.
Click the HelpFilesNavigationMenuNewIcon to start the Contract Type entry in the Record Editing section.
Contract ID - This is the system assigned record number which is inserted automatically when the record is initially saved.
Contract Type - Enter a Description of this Contract Type which is used to identify the type of monitored contract(s) being offered by the Company.
The Contract Type Description may up to 50 characters in length and include upper and/or lower case letters, numbers, spaces and normally used punctuation marks.
Click the HelpFilesNavigationMenuSaveIcon to record this Contract Type entry.
Repeat this process, as needed, to define each Contract Type.
